A cyberattack on Collins Aerospace's MUSE software disrupted check-in systems at major European airports including Heathrow, Berlin, and Brussels on Saturday. Passengers experienced long queues and flight delays. While disruption eased significantly by Sunday, some delays persisted. Investigations into the hacking incident are underway. The incident is the latest in a series of cyberattacks affecting various sectors, highlighting growing vulnerabilities.
